316L Stainless-steel Plate
316L chrome steel plate is noted for its superb corrosion resistance, significantly in opposition to chlorides together with other industrial solvents.

Critical Functions:

Minimal Carbon Material: The 'L' in 316L stands for minimal carbon, which enhances its resistance to sensitization (grain boundary carbide precipitation).
Top-quality Corrosion Resistance: Specifically productive in environments with chlorides, acids, and alkalis.
Higher Temperature Resistance: Maintains toughness and toughness at elevated temperatures.
Weldability: Small carbon material increases weldability without the chance of carbide precipitation.
Purposes:

Maritime Environments: Ideal for shipbuilding, offshore oil rigs, and various marine apps.
Chemical Processing: Employed in chemical storage and processing gear.
Pharmaceutical Tools: Desired for its hygienic Homes and resistance to aggressive chemical substances.
Food items and Beverage Industry: Used in equipment that need to retain demanding hygiene requirements.
304 Stainless Steel Plate
304 stainless steel plate will be the most widely employed chrome steel quality, presenting a equilibrium of energy, corrosion resistance, and value-performance.

Critical Characteristics:

Flexibility: Well suited for a wide array of apps on account of its outstanding formability and weldability.
Corrosion Resistance: Resists rust and corrosion in mild environments.
Non-Magnetic: In its annealed affliction, 304 stainless steel is non-magnetic.
Value-Productive: Provides a very good stability in between efficiency and cost.
Purposes:

Kitchen Equipment: Employed in sinks, countertops, and appliances.
Architectural Apps: Ideal for ornamental things, roofing, and cladding.
Industrial Products: Utilized in equipment, tanks, and piping.
Automotive Sections: Frequently used in exhaust units and trim.
316 Stainless-steel Plate
316 stainless steel plate is similar to 304 but While using the addition of molybdenum, which appreciably improves its corrosion resistance.

Important Features:

Enhanced Corrosion Resistance: The addition of molybdenum offers superior resistance to pitting and crevice corrosion.
Substantial Power: Gives superb toughness and sturdiness.
Warmth Resistance: Can withstand large temperatures, rendering it suitable for higher-heat 316l stainless steel plate programs.
Weldability: Maintains its Houses even after welding.
Apps:

Chemical Processing: Employed in environments subjected to aggressive chemical compounds.
Health-related Equipment: Preferred for surgical instruments and implants.
Marine Products: Perfect for parts subjected to seawater and brine.
Petrochemical Industry: Used in refining tools and storage tanks.
